1 Followers
26 Following
citygame32

citygame32

SPOILER ALERT!

Cómo configurar un sitemap xml Wordpress perfecto

Publicado Porel 14 Mar, 2016



Si tienes instalado algún complemento de posicionamiento web en buscadores como All in one posicionamiento en buscadores Pack o Yoast posicionamiento web probablemente ya tienes un sitemap XML mas
¿lo tienes configurado apropiadamente?No solo hay que crear un sitemap XML de nuestra web, yy a las, además hay que configurarlo bien.


 


Índice de contenidos


¿Qué es el Sitemap XML y para qué sirve?


Un Sitemap XML básicamente
es un archivo que notifica a los rastreadores de los buscadores sobre la estructura de tu web, listando todos (o parte) de las URLs existentes. Todos y cada uno de los bots de los buscadores utilizan este sitemap como guía inicial para rastrear tu página web.


Un Sitemap XML
puede contener información (metadatos) sobre la frecuencia de actualización de cada URL, la prioridadde la misma y, en el caso de vídeos, la duración de los contenidos.


Se pueden (y debe) crear sitemaps específicos para imágenes, vídeo y de contenido especializado para móviles. También es muy aconsejable crear una versión de tu sitemap XML comprimido (gzip).


Los motores de búsqueda no se guiarán solamente por la información dada en el Sitemap XML mas es su primer mapa a tu página web, tendrán en cuenta tus indicaciones,
siempre te beneficiará y jamás te perjudicará tenerlo, eso seguro.


Así que crear
un sitemap XML es la primera línea de ataque para el adecuado indexado en los SERPde los motores de búsqueda, y configurarlo adecuadamente es una tarea fundamental para cualquier administrador web, pero los ajustes por defecto de los plugins son eso, por defecto, y no se amoldan a todas y cada una de las webs existentes.


Si empleas el complemento Yoast SEO, sin poder determinar más ajustes importantes, así que nos concentraremos en los ajustes que sí están libres en
, prácticamente iguales que los que encontrarás el fantástico (mas pesado) plugin, que sí dejan configurar con precisión un sitemap XML.


Qué incluir en el Sitemap XML


En el sitemap
debes incluir todas las URLs en las que haya contenido relacionado con la temática de tu weby que ofrezcan
información única, valiosa y relevantepara los lectores y, lógicamente, también para los buscadores.


Así que, como regla de partida,
el Sitemap XML siempre y en todo momento deberá incluir:



  1. La portada de tu web, lo más importante, la vía de entrada a tu lugar.

  2. Páginas: tu contenido constante y único que te define y explica lo que eres, a qué te dedicas, qué ofreces, cuáles son tus valores.

  3. Entradas: tus publicaciones periódicas, en las que ofreces información valiosa a los visitantes de tu página web sobre el contenido de tu sector o bien negocio.

  4. Taxonomías: aquellas que sirvan para organizar y jerarquizar tus contenidos, como etiquetas y categorías.

También, dependiendo de la orientación y segmento de tu web,
el Sitemap XML puede incluir:



  1. Vídeos: señalando la duración, categoría del contenido y clasificación de audiencia.

  2. Imágenes/Adjuntos: especificando los metadatos que las identifiquen.

  3. Contenido para móviles: en especial si ofreces páginas especiales para móviles viejos, mas también si tienes definida una estrategia móvil precisa.

  4. Temas en los foros</ <a href="https://citiface.com/es/presupuesto-tienda-online-la-rioja">presupuesto pagina web >, si los tuvieses.

  5. Tipos de contenido personalizado, como proyectos, portafolios, etc. si son relevantes para tu temática y estrategia SEO.

  6. Archivos de autor, necesarios para los algoritmos de autoría de Google.

consultor analitica web ,
si hay URLs que quieres añadir al Sitemap y no las has generado con WordPressel complemento te deja añadirlas manualmente y configurar sus parámetros.


Qué NO incluir en el Sitemap XML


Va a depender mucho de tu estrategia de contenidos mas como regla de partida el Sitemap XML no debería incluir:


  • URLs con contenido duplicado.
  • URLs de las páginas de adjuntos generadas automáticamente por WordPress.
  • URLs de afiliación.
  • Archivos por data.
  • Taxonomías autogeneradas por el tema o complementos que no ofrezcan organización o bien jerarquía de contenidos.

Adicionalmente, también puedes excluir URLs manualmente, aunque globalmente hayas indicando que se incluyan, indicando el ID o slug de las mismas.


Frecuencia de actualización del Sitemap XML


Un parámetro importante, que los buscadores valorarán, será la frecuencia con que se actualizan tus URLs. Los plugins que te permiten configurar estos valores te ofrecen los próximos valores:



  1. No sobrescribir: Con lo que se utilizarán los valores por defecto del complemento. Los ajustes por defecto suelen ser para blogs así que como norma no lo dejes nunca así.

  2. Siempre(always): Pides a los rastreadores que visiten tus URLs con la mayor frecuencia posible, cada minuto de ser posible. Configuración adecuada para sitios con muchas noticias que se actualizan con muchísima frecuencia, como diarios digitales de primera importancia.

  3. Cada hora(hourly): Quieres que los bots te visiten cada hora. Adecuado para sitios de noticias que publican contenido nuevo varias veces al día.

  4. Cada día(daily): A fin de que te visiten una vez al día, ideal para weblogs que publican una entrada diaria como mucho.

  5. Cada semana(weekly): Si actualizas el weblog algunas veces es una buena configuración.

  6. Cada mes(monthly): Típico para webs estáticas sin sección de noticias o bien blog, para que los rastreadores revisen si has alterado la información de tus páginas.

  7. Cada año(yearly): Para webs únicamente estáticas y páginas de aterrizaje (
    landing pages) que no cambian nunca, pero que deseas que Google se acuerde de que existen.

Y ahora brota la duda habitual
¿qué frecuencia le asigno a cada género de URL?Porque claro, uno desea que le visiten los motores de búsqueda cuanto más mejor. Ahora bien, muchas visitas de los rastreadores no implica que te vayan a posicionar mejor en los Search Engines Ranking Positions.


De hecho, los algoritmos de
los rastreadores podrían «
pensar» que les engañas
si marcas, por ejemplo, una frecuencia
alwaysy no actualizas nada de tu contenido nunca o bien lo haces con poquísima frecuencia.



La norma que debes aplicar siempre con los motores de búsqueda es no engañarles ni tratar de engañarles nunca por el hecho de que te van a pillar sí o sí, y te penalizarán si les produces un consumo de sus recursos inapropiado al resultado que obtendrán. Google y Microsoft son empresas millonarias mas no se hicieron ricas dejándose engañar, y son muy recelosos del dinero que emplean para gestionar sus herramientas.


Siempre suelo aconsejar la regla universal de … «

Facilita la vida a los buscadores y te premiarán, complícales la tarea y te penalizarán
«.


Teniendo esto en mente,
debes asignar una frecuencia conveniente a la realidad de cada género de URLque incluyas en el Sitemap XML, siendo honesto con tus ajustes.


Para un blog comouna configuración adecuada sería más o menos así:



  1. Portada:
    alwaysporque publico cada día, en ocasiones múltiples veces, y en muchas ocasiones modifico títulos y extractos de las entradas, con lo que lo que aparece en portada puede cambiar. También sería válido el valor
    hourly.

  2. Entradas:
    hourlypor el mismo motivo precedente, puesto que es bastante frecuente que modifique entradas una vez publicadas, para corregir fallos, añadir links, aportar más contenido que va surgiendo con la conversación con los lectores en los comentarios.

  3. Taxonomías: como muestran el archivo de las entradas debería ser exactamente el mismo parámetro que uses para ellas, en el ejemplo que estamos siguiendo
    hourly.

  4. Páginas:
    daily | weekly | monthly | yearly, cualquiera de estos valores, pues va a depender mucho de cada cuanto tiempo modificas la información de tus páginas. Frente a la duda pon la misma frecuencia que para las entradas, aunque un valor razonable, aun ambicioso, sería
    daily.

  5. Páginas de autor: exactamente la misma frecuencia que establezcas para las taxonomías, siendo un fichero de entradas.

Sobre todo ten en cuenta de qué estamos hablando, de cada cuanto se actualiza la URL, cada cuanto tiempo muestra información nueva o bien actualizada.


Así que debes distinguir meridianamente las páginas del archivo, como portada y taxonomías, de las entradas y páginas. Las primeras van a actualizarse toda vez que haya contenido nuevo, las segundas únicamente cuando las modifiques independientemente. Ten esto en mente al acotar las frecuencias.


Prioridades del Sitemap XML


Un parámetro de gran relevancia es la prioridad que asignemos a cada URL en nuestro Sitemap. Los ajustes disponibles vienen en formato numérico del tipo: diez, 0.9, 0.8, y así consecutivamente hasta 0.0, y siempre y en toda circunstancia incluyen la opción
No sobreescribir, para utilizar los valores por defecto del plugin.


Aunque el valor sea de este tipo luego se mostrará en el Sitemap XML como 1.0 por cien , 90 por ciento , ochenta por ciento y así sucesivamente.


Esto se traduce en que
le vamos a decir a los buscadores qué valor porcentual tiene cada URL de nuestra página web en el SEOde todo nuestro sitio, ahí es nada.


Vamos, que tienes que
decidir qué valor tiene sobre el peso total del posicionamiento de tu web cada tipo de contenido o archivo, decisión difícil donde las haya ¿o no?


Mi consejo es que
siempre, siempre y en toda circunstancia, asignes el valor 1.0 (1.0 por ciento ) a la portada, como elemento esencial del SEO de tu web (por norma general) en tanto que contiene la meta
titleprincipal y la información más relevante y actualizada de tu lugar.



Para las páginas deberás aplicar el valor noventa (90 por cien )pues siempre y en toda circunstancia deben contener información totalmente relevante sobre lo que eres, lo que ofreces.


Si, además, publicas
entradas con contenido de valor, que uses para reforzar tu posicionamiento, les asignes también el valor diez (diez por ciento ) o bien como poco 0.9 (noventa por cien ) o 0.8 (ochenta por ciento ) en tanto que los buscadores web se nutren principalmente de contenido relevante y actualizado.


A partir de aquí
no hay regla fija aparte de no asignar valores altísimos al resto de URLs, salvo estrategia específica sobre algún género de contenido (vídeo, imágenes, etcétera) básicamente para que no compitan con tus principales URLs ( portada, páginas, entradas).


Básicamente, lo que le estás diciendo a Google y Bing es dónde publicas tu contenido más relevante con tu temática, nicho o negocio, y
qué prefieres que posicione por delante de otras URLsen caso de dudas o bien necesidad de ahorro de recursos.


Más parámetros a tomar en consideración en el Sitemap XML


Adicionalmente, nuestros queridos plugins para WP también nos ofrecen otros parámetros interesantes a configurar, y los primordiales son los siguientes:



  • Crear un sitemap XML comprimido (gzip): Créalo siempre, en verdad los rastreadores los leen más rápido que los estándar.

  • Avisar a Google y Bing: Aquí el plugin lanza un ping a los rastreadores cuando se actualiza tu sitemap a fin de que pasen a ver qué ha cambiado. Creo que huelga decir que lo actives siempre y en todo momento.

  • Generar el sitemap XML dinámicamente, cuando publiques contenido nuevo: ¿De verdad hace falta que te afirme si hay que activarlo o bien no? Vale, sí.

  • Programar actualización del sitemap XML: Esto es por si quieres detallar un horario específico en el que actualizar tu sitemap. Esto es debido a que la creación del sitemap, en webs con muchas URLs (miles), puede consumir bastantes recursos de tu servidor, y puede ser mejor elegir ciertas horas para evitar que se ralentice tu web si no tienes un servidor potente. Si lo empleas debes desactivar la actualización automática cuando publiques contenido nuevo, por obvias razones.

  • Prefijo del mapa del sitio: Por defecto el prefijo es
    sitemapcon lo que tu mapa del lugar XML se llamará
    sitemap.xml. Solo deberías mudarlo si hay conflicto con algún otro sitemap.

  • Crear índices del mapa del sitio: Si activas esto el mapa del sitio inicialmente no mostrará todas tus URLs, sino que será una especie de menú con enlaces a otros sitemaps, organizados por género de contenido (páginas, entradas, taxonomías, etc.), en los que sí estarán las URLs de cada contenedor. No debes activarlo a menos que tu página web contenga tantas URLs (la norma es que
    no contenga más de cincuenta URLs y no pese más de 10 Mb) que ralentice demasiado la visualización del sitemap (
    Nota: el plugin Yoast posicionamiento en buscadores crea el sitemap con índices por defecto, sin posibilidad de cambiar). Lo dicho, lo idóneo, salvo que tengas muchísimas URLs, es mostrarlo directamente, sin índices, para facilitar la navegación y también indexado a los rastreadores, sin hacer que visiten varias URLs para ver la estructura de tu web. Si precisas crear el índice el plugin All in One posicionamiento en buscadores Paquete lo crea con enlaces a los sitemaps comprimidos de cada género de contenido, mucho más eficaces y rápidos de carga para los rastreadores.

  • Añadir link al archivo robots.txt virtual: WordPress siempre y en toda circunstancia ofrece un fichero robots.txt virtual. Si vas a crear un archivo robots.txt propio (con All in one SEO Paquete puedes hacerlo fácilmente) no actives esta casilla, singularmente si ambos estarán en la misma senda, en general en la carpeta raíz del lugar. Si no crearás tu fichero actívala, es mejor algo que nada.

  • Añadir sitemap en formato HTML: El complemento Google XML Sitemaps te ofrece esta opción, pero no es preciso. El Sitemap xml normal ofrece los estilos precisos, y básicos, para que los rastreadores los lean apropiadamente.

  • Cambiar la ruta del sitemap: Otro ajuste que permite el complemento Google XML Sitemaps, muy útil si no la carpeta raíz de tu sitio no tiene permisos de escritura, permitiéndote guardar el sitemap en otra carpetita.

 


¿Dudas?


Si te ha quedado alguna duda plantéala en los comentarios y entre todos la resolvemos.


VALORA Y COMPARTE ESTE ARTÍCULO PARA MEJORAR LA CALIDAD DEL BLOG…